MOVE - Murdoch Online Veterinary Education
Webinars
MOVE is an exciting and highly educational series of live, interactive webinars presented by leading specialists in their field. No matter where you are, you can participate from the comfort of your own home or office. All sessions are also archived so if you are unable to attend or get called away during the presentation, you will be able to review it at a later time.
